我试图在维基页面上放置一个对象列表,供几个团队标记他们使用的对象。为此,我为每个团队制作了一个包含列的表格,并希望在这些列中放置一个复选框供团队标记。
这是我想要做的基本想法:
<html>
<head>
<title>Object Usage by Team</title>
</head>
<body>
<table>
<tr>
<th>Object</th>
<th>Team 1</th>
<th>Team 2</th>
<th>Team 3</th>
</tr>
<tr>
<td>Object 1</td>
<td><input type="checkbox" name="Team" value="Team 1"></td>
<td><input type="checkbox" name="Team" value="Team 2"></td>
<td><input type="checkbox" name="Team" value="Team 3"></td>
</tr>
</table>
</body>
</html>
有没有办法在MediaWiki中使用复选框单元格进行表格并存储复选框状态?
答案 0 :(得分:4)
您可以使用其中一个扩展程序在文章中插入表单:
最简单的方法是,如果您对用户使用wikicode(编辑页面)选中复选框感到满意,可以使用Extension:Chklist
语法就像这个
一样简单<chklist>
[x] Checked item
[] Unchecked item
</chklist>
如果这些扩展都没有帮助你,也许可以创建自己的扩展程序。
更新08/2018 Extension:Chklist已由mediawiki存档,并且存在一个重大安全风险警告,因为它容易受到跨站点脚本攻击。
Extension:Checklist可以用作替代品,最后一次更新是在2018/04/18进行此编辑。 虽然,我没有使用它,也不知道它的语法。